The CPA are excited to work with the Royal Pharmaceutical Society to provide CPD resources

Access RPS CPD resources

The Royal Pharmaceutical Society (RPS) have developed a range of clinical webinars to support pharmacists during the COVID-19 pandemic. All of the webinars follow a Question and answer format focusing on practical tips and sharing good practice.

The CPA are excited to work with the RPS to provide these webinars as a CPD package for CPA members. Once you register (for FREE) as a user on the RPS website, you can watch the following recordings at any time and obtain a CPD certificate for your records.

Step 1.

Register for free on the RPS website or login with your RPS membership details if you are an RPS International member.

Step 2.

Watch the webinar recording and then answer a quiz to obtain your certificate. The webinar links will take you to the RPS website so make sure to come back to this page for the quizzes!

A score of more than 60% is required to obtain the CPD certificate.
Note: These webinars reflect practice in the UK, local practice in your country may differ.
